Fort Robinson dates back to the last half of the 1900s and was used until WWII ended. Initially it was a major base for the US Army troops assigned to kill or confine to reservations Native Americans and here Chief Crazy Horse was killed after his capture following his defeat of the 7th Calvary under the incompetent Col. Custer. The cafe is in the lodge and is decorated with old photos and army equipment. My 8 oz. buffalo hamburger was very good. It came with a bag of potato chips. The service is excellent.
